Output 385fc51a36b27cefb1b5c3c2cf3bf325e2bdd3c0b8fb25f3007c8990c3647215:12

value
133445358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40d3acdb4840d5f1bb9039edb2a27efda46788c OP_EQUAL
address
MTEPLKAYdms7NKszrczSzH1kHhcxP3547d
transaction
385fc51a36b27cefb1b5c3c2cf3bf325e2bdd3c0b8fb25f3007c8990c3647215
spent
true